Block 961,681
Block Hash
d760697a026e39d722af9b84ab706a156cac6567961a1edaf02175472b
66408a
Previous Block Hash
59b64a20fb7a0c16a6e2fb83aac3e0dabcd56180a34d62a03690970465 9a5329
Mined
Transactions
2
Difficulty
34.25 M
Size
400 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
180,961.47724
PEPE